Operating Hours Reduced at Disney World Theme Parks Beginning This Weekend

If you’re planning on visiting Walt Disney World, the park hours are shortening as Disney predicts lower crowds following the holiday season. Three of the four Walt Disney World theme parks will have shorter operating hours, with Disney’s Hollywood Studios being the only exception. Here’s a look at the changes:

  • Magic Kingdom (starting Jan. 10): Returns to 7pm closing time (currently 8pm closing time)
  • EPCOT (starting Jan. 10): Returns to 8pm closing time (currently 9pm closing time)
  • Disney’s Animal Kingdom (starting Jan. 11): Returns to 5pm closing time (currently 6pm closing time)

As we stated earlier, Disney’s Hollywood Studios doesn’t change its operating hours this weekend. A change to shorter hours is on the schedule, but it’s not going to take place until later this month:

  • Disney’s Hollywood Studios (starting Jan. 24): Returns to 10am opening (currently 9am opening)
